Problems installing K&N FIPK Gen2
I tried installing this today and I got stuck on step #6 where it says to remove the EVAP canister from the stock bracket. I looked later on in the instructions and it says you need to take pieces off of the stock bracket to put on the new one but, I don't have a stock bracket. My truck only has one little thing on the inner fender, nothing near to what the pictures/instructions say. Heres two pics of my inner fender, maybe someone this has happened to someone else. This kit is designed for my truck so thats not the problem.
Yea, mine was the same way. I dont really know why its like that, but you dont have to do anything to the EVAP. Just move on and skip any and all steps referring to it. Its not a problem, its not in the way, and nothing attaches to it. Heres mine i just decided to skip it and see what happens. everything worked out fine. thier directions suck, so if you need any more help, just let me know!
